Output d91a162e2d8a3d1e2bd8c64258f0ccd8d4fc99a0e36e5b30bd88d0271649efff:0

value
1070181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a2a8a81d50eaa8e2637de413379ee971e16c583 OP_EQUAL
address
39umhcT5oKQefsdbXe28jAKB53qWii3d2L
transaction
d91a162e2d8a3d1e2bd8c64258f0ccd8d4fc99a0e36e5b30bd88d0271649efff
confirmations
153423
spent
true